Henry Calder was from a Hampshire cricketing family that could be traced back to the glory days of Hambledon. He played a handful of games for Hampshire as an amateur batsman and offspinner, with moderate success, and then after emigrating with his family to South Africa, he went on to captain Western Province in the Currie Cup. He returned to England at the outbreak of war in 1914. He was an accountant by profession.
